At its heart, the chicken road game relies on a remarkably simple control scheme, typically involving tapping or clicking to make the chicken jump. The timing of these jumps is paramount, as even a slight miscalculation can lead to a disastrous collision. What adds complexity is the randomized nature of the traffic flow. Vehicles don’t adhere to a set pattern, forcing players to constantly assess the situation and adjust their strategy. This constant demand for attention and rapid decision-making is a key element of the game’s appeal. It’s easy to pick up and play, but mastering the art of the safe crossing requires practice and a keen sense of timing.
Successful gameplay isn't solely about reacting to immediate threats. Skilled players learn to anticipate the movements of approaching vehicles. Observing the speed and distance of cars allows for a more calculated jump, minimizing risk. Furthermore, recognizing patterns, even within the randomness, can reveal opportunities for safe passage. The chicken road game’s addictive nature is rooted in the psychological principles of risk and reward. Each successful crossing provides a small burst of dopamine, reinforcing the desire to continue playing. The constant threat of failure, however, adds an element of tension that keeps players engaged. This delicate balance between risk and reward is a common feature of many popular games. The feeling of overcoming a challenging obstacle, such as navigating a particularly dense stretch of traffic, is intensely satisfying. This game taps into our inherent desire for accomplishment and provides a readily accessible pathway to achieving it, albeit in a virtual space. It requires a level of concentration and hand-eye coordination that is both stimulating and rewarding.
